Top 7 Features Your Restaurant POS System Needs
As the owner or manager of a restaurant, having an efficient and effective point-of-sale (POS) system is crucial to the success of your business. A restaurant POS system allows you to manage your orders, payments, and inventory, among other important aspects of your restaurant. However, not all POS systems are created equal. Here are the top 7 features your restaurant POS system needs to have in order to maximize efficiency and increase profitability:
Easy-to-use interface
Your restaurant POS system should have an intuitive and user-friendly interface. This will help ensure that your staff can quickly and easily navigate the system, minimizing mistakes and reducing training time.
Menu customization
Your POS system should allow for easy customization of your menu, including adding, deleting, and modifying menu items. This is especially important for restaurants that frequently change their menu offerings.
Table management
An effective restaurant POS system should allow you to manage tables, track orders, and assign servers to specific tables. This will help ensure that your restaurant runs smoothly and efficiently.
Payment options
Your POS system should support a wide range of payment options, including credit cards, debit cards, cash, and mobile payments. This will make it easier for your customers to pay and improve their overall experience at your restaurant.
Inventory management
A good POS system should allow you to manage your inventory and track ingredients and supplies in real-time. This will help you avoid running out of popular items, reduce food waste, and maximize profitability.
Reporting and analytics
Your POS system should provide detailed reporting and analytics, allowing you to track sales, monitor inventory, and identify trends. This will help you make informed decisions about your restaurant’s operations and improve your bottom line.
Integration with other systems
Your POS system should integrate seamlessly with other systems, such as your accounting software, online ordering platform, and loyalty program. This will help you streamline your operations and improve customer engagement.
A restaurant POS system is a critical tool for managing your restaurant’s operations and increasing profitability. When selecting a POS system, be sure to look for one that offers an easy-to-use interface, menu customization, table management, payment options, inventory management, reporting and analytics, and integration with other systems.
